PESTEL Analysis
Factors Descriptions
Political - There are 3 states surrounding the Michigan Lake, making the approval of the plan
more complicated
- While the IDEM and EPA approve BP expansion plan, most citizen and other NGOs
were opposed of the plan fearing it would harm the environment of the lake and
the communities surrounding it
- Mayor of Chicago pledged to make Chicago the ‘greenest’ city in America
- Chicago residents and politicians invested millions of dollars to clean up Lake
Michigan, develop environmentally sustainable business practices, and constructed
the highest number of environmentally-friendly building projects in the US
- Mayor of Chicago, democrats and republicans were against the plan of BP. Political
parties threatened to take legal actions to block the permit.
- The U.S. Congress overwhelmingly passed a “resolution’’ to urge the EPA to
reconsider issuance of the permit
- Impact of adverse event on BP’s reputation and engagement with other oil rich
regions: green policies, environmental regulation
Economic - Regional and global consumer demand for gasoline was rising, which helped push
prices toward record highs
- Global demand for oil was expected to double between 1980-2004 and 2004-2030
- The initiation of the plan can certainly create thousands of jobs as well as economic
benefits to the surrounding societies
- Impact of cost associated with previous scandals: environmental clean up,
damages, litigations, research and development
Social - The US social trend is against the expansion of BP in Whiting as it causes
environmental harm to the environment
- Social opinion mostly is against the plan due to environmental concern
- Impact of previous adverse events on BP’s reputation
Technological - The technological development of Oil refining presented environmental concerns
- The imported oil from Canada required complex operation as well as an increase of

, 34% of the discharge of ammonia and 54% increase in Total Suspended Solid.
- The firm invested $3.8 billion to improve capacity and technological aspect of the
refinery but it did not lower the level of discharge into the environment
Environmental - Thousands of citizens, a host of environmental groups, national politicians were
opposed to the expansion for fear of increasing pollution in Lake Michigan
Legal - The legal system requires both state governments and citizens to approve the plan
- The approval process is complicated and lengthy
- The law established a certain level of discharge that BP are allowed to operate in
the US. The firm claimed that it satisfied all requirements from the EPA and the
IDEM with its waste management plan.
- BP plan, in term of its environmental impacts, fit the laws of Indiana which was
claimed to be tougher than federal law
- Federal Indiana lawmakers met the CEO of BP to pressure him to stop the plan



Indication from the PESTEL analysis
- In almost every aspect, the BP plan to expand to lake Michigan was opposed by the public and major
government agencies
- The environmental concern from the people of the states around the lake posed the biggest threats
towards the expansion plan
- However, the BP plan and its environmental impacts projection fitted with almost all requirements
of federal law as well as states’ regulations
- The economic impacts that the plan, should it be proceeded, is tremendous to the different states
surrounding the lake, especially Indiana as the direct recipient of the economic benefit
- The overall demand for oil and its related product from the market standpoint urges the expansion
of BP in the lake area as supplies can and will significantly increase to match demand surplus
- To conclude, the economic benefits that the plan brought forth are the main reasons for some
government agencies to approve the plan. However, the potential environmental impacts, while has
been examined and approve by government agencies such as IDEM and EPA, posed great concern
and opposition from the public.
